Fixing Double DataLayer Pushes on Ecommerce Events because of eventModel

solution to avoid the recognition of double datalayer pushes

Here’s a typical problem in Shopify and Woocommerce configurations: in Google Tag Manager, you notice double datalayer pushes of ecommerce events, specifically “view_item”, “add_to_cart”, and “purchase” events. This pollutes your data, and it’s caused by the simultaneous presence of one app or plugin pushing GA4 DataLayer events, and another one pushing Google Shopping DataLayer events. … Read more

GTM & GA4 DataLayer Blueprints for Ecommerce Measurement

an image of the datalayer seen from the chrome web inspector

Here’s Fuel LAB‘s internal Data Layer blueprints designed for successful integration with the Google Marketing Platform. We use this daily as all of our integrations are done this way. This documentation covers all the DataLayer Push for GTM and GA4; the syntax is compatible with all the products of the Google Marketing Platform. This tracking … Read more